Output 6261de0b24fbb3ab59004f985ea3ff56f5af14497cca549931374e0fb8ee4bc0:1

value
1602261062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2a4772e3bd9acc143dd8aa93b2dc395e9f57242 OP_EQUAL
address
3HybDxR7pgx2iwHsR4FfDnudCkSnFP5C3i
transaction
6261de0b24fbb3ab59004f985ea3ff56f5af14497cca549931374e0fb8ee4bc0
confirmations
404826
spent
true